D Abram's asked about pediatricians and sleep questions.  Most pediatricians do ask about sleeping during routine exams.  This is usually, as Ms Abrams suggested, to find out if there are any issues regarding sleep that the parents are concerned about.  It is also an opportunity to reinforce what is normal, i.e., that a 2 month old should be waking to feed at night despite misadvice that the parents might have been given from neighbors, etc.
